Description


The National Institute of Justice (NIJ) Cybersecurity Grants and Funding is an organization that is dedicated to improving the cybersecurity landscape in the United States. As a part of the Department of Justice, NIJ is the research, development, and evaluation arm of the department and is responsible for promoting and enhancing the nation's criminal justice system through science and technology.

The organization offers a variety of grants and funding opportunities for agencies, organizations, and individuals who are working towards improving cybersecurity in the United States.
